解决React报错React Hook useEffect has a missing dependency
Borislav Hadzhiev 人气:0总览
当useEffect
钩子使用了一个我们没有包含在其依赖数组中的变量或函数时,会产生"React Hook useEffect has a missing dependency"警告。为了解决该错误,禁用某一行的eslint
规则,或者将变量移动到useEffect
钩子内。
这里有个示例用来展示警告是如何发生的。
// App.js import React, {useEffect, useState} from 'react'; export default function App() { const [address, setAddress] = useState({country: '', city: ''}); //
加载全部内容
- 猜你喜欢
- 用户评论